Before assembling a caster, you need to know what all of the parts do and what makes each piece important. Casters typically have six parts, and you’ll need to know what each one does before correctly assembling it.

The top plate of a caster is the mounting system that holds the item. The top plate has four holes that are cut using a computer-guided cutting machine. The stem of a caster is another part that attaches the wheel to the mount. The axle bolt holds the wheel to the yoke, and the yoke is the frame that connects the top plate and the stem. Finally, the yoke and wheel are connected through a metallic ring called the race.

Caster wheels should be easy to roll.

One of the main features of a caster is its wheel. Essentially, the wheel provides leverage, or support, to the load. You can think of the wheel as a lever spun about a fulcrum or axle. Lighter loads need smaller wheels, while heavier ones require larger ones. A caster’s wheel size varies from 40mm to 18 inches. The diameter of the wheel determines its ability to support the load.

To make your caster wheels easy to roll, select a material that is not too hard to push or move. Polyurethane wheels, for example, are highly durable, have good abrasion resistance, and are easy to roll. Look for a chart that shows the wheel’s performance on various floors. Each caster has a load rating, and the number of casters increases the overall load rating capacity.

Caster wheels should be easy to remove

To replace a caster wheel, you need to know how to get it off the chair. First, you need to turn it upside down and get full access to the caters underneath. If your chair is cumbersome, this process may be challenging. Also, be sure that the replacement caster meets the weight requirements of the item you want to mount it on. You can also check whether the caster wheel is removable by using pliers.

To clean chewing gum residue from your caster wheels, you can use a cotton swab or tissue. To get into small crevices, try using tweezers. You can also use a Goo Gone spray gel if the gum remains. You must spray the gel above the gum and allow it to soak for at least five minutes before you attempt to remove it.
